Idaho Press, Kara Craig named to newly created post at Jet Health Inc

BOISE — Jet Health Inc., a regional provider of home health and hospice services, has announced the appointment of Kara Craig to the newly created position of vice president of personal care.

In her new role, Craig will oversee all personal care programs for Jet Health, which currently includes the provision of non-medical personal care services, generally to assist patients with activities of daily life. Personal care may include, but is not limited to, homemaker duties, light chores, home maintenance, respite care, case management and companionship. Her responsibilities include oversight of administrative staff, increasing brand awareness, expanding Jet Health’s network of caregiver employees at each location, home care regulation compliance and growing and strengthening personal care programs across the Company’s service areas.

This appointment marks a promotion for Craig as she served as executive director since April 2020 for First Choice Home Health and Hospice, a Boise, Idaho-based home health and hospice company owned by Jet Health, Inc. In this capacity, she oversaw all programs for First Choice across the Treasure Valley market. First Choice became a Jet Health company in April 2019. Prior, Craig was the hospice administrator at First Choice for 10 years. She has more than 32 years of experience in administrative leadership positions, including 14 years serving as chief executive officer of the Children’s Home Society of Idaho.

Craig, a Boise native, graduated from Boise State University with a bachelor’s degree in interpersonal communication and earned a master’s degree in psychology from Pepperdine University. She currently serves as a board member of the Idaho Health Care Association. Previously, Craig served on the board of the Boise Downtown Rotary Club, Idaho Association of American Mothers, and HAPPEN (Healthcare Associates Providing Positive Education and Networking).
